My father has a 2003 Silverado 1500, 5.3L 4x4 151k miles Automatic. He was driving it, stopped at a stop sign, went to give it gas and NOTHING. The truck was still running (fine), But the Information panel on the Cluster was cycling through the languages and also read "TOT.PART" in the cycle. When putting it in reverse there is loud noise, but not when in drive. Crawled underneath and may seem like the driveshaft could be in a bind??
I have read the codes and this what it returned:
P0332
P1516
P0120
P0141
P0220
P0442
P0449
The First 2 were displayed twice.
I am really thinking that this is not a "transmission is toast" issue, only because it seems quite coincidental that the cluster is acting up at the same time. We have checked trans oil, then again with running and it is lower (was told that means pump is working). Any ideas/tests/ other people with the same problem? Thank you for any help!

The only way is have the ignition fuse ING 0 go open , this power the transmission solenoid and the instrument panel
